| Retinal function in relation to improved glycaemic control in type 1 diabetes. | |

AIMS/HYPOTHESIS: To study long-term changes in retinal function in response to sustained glycaemia reduction in participants with type 1 diabetes. METHODS: Prospective study using objective measures of retinal function in 17 participants with type 1 diabetes mellitus and minimal to moderate retinopathy who switched from conventional subcutaneous injection to continuous subcutaneous infusion of insulin (CSII). RESULTS: Glycated haemoglobin HbA(1c) gradually decreased from 9.1% at baseline before CSII to 7.4% after 1 year on CSII. Glycaemia was markedly reduced within 1 week after initiation of CSII and remained stable thereafter. Dark adaptation and retinal electroretinographic function at 1, 4 and 16 weeks after initiation of CSII were comparable with baseline values, whereas a significant improvement in rod photoreceptor dark adaptation and dark-adapted b-wave amplitudes were seen after 52 weeks (time to rod-cone break -25% [p < 0.0001], time to a standardised rod intercept -13% [p < 0.0001], dark-adapted rod b-wave full-field amplitude +15% [p = 0.0125], standard combined rod-cone b-wave amplitude +8% [p = 0.049]). No detectable change was observed in cone adaptation, electroretinographic cone function or retinopathy. CONCLUSIONS/INTERPRETATION: After initiation of CSII, the retinal visual pathway of the rods improved with a delay of more than 4 months, over a time scale comparable with the duration of the diabetic retinopathy early worsening response to sustained glycaemia reduction. This indicates that glycaemia has a long-term effect on the disposition of functional capacity in the retinal visual pathway of rod photoreceptors, the cells that appear to be driving the development of diabetic retinopathy. |
